Nagaland wins three Gold; 16 medals in total so far

Dimapur, Jan. 9 (EMN): Nagaland has so far won 16 medals with three gold’ at the ongoing 4th Northeast Taekwondo Championship currently underway at DSA, Karimganj. Nagaland 's Neikhozo Naprantsu struck the first gold medal for the state in the U-33 kgs cadet boys on Monday. Hinglakbo Nike and Zakieneikho Peseyie secured the second and third gold medal in the U-45 kg and over 65 kg cadet boys category on Tuesday. Nagaland also won four silver and eight bronze medals, totaling 16 in various categories in the championship. The championship is organised by Karimganj District Taekwondo Association and played under the aegis of North-East Taekwondo Union (NETU). A 45 member team under the aegis of Nagaland Taekwondo Association (NTA) is taking part in the three-day championship which will conclude on Wednesday. Six Northeast states of Assam, Arunachal Pradesh, Manipur, Mizoram, Meghalaya Nagaland and SSB teams with 232 players and 25 officials are part of the championship.
